摘要
Disilane unit-fused poly (diphenylamine) (poly(10, 11-dihydro-10,11-disila-5,10, 10,11,11-pentamethyl-5H-dibenz[b,f]azepine-2,8-diyl), PDSiAzep) were prepared and properties of these compounds were studied. Oxidation of PDSiAzep led to related disiloxane-fused poly(diphenylamine) (poly(5,7-disila-6-oxa-5,5,7,7,12-pentamethyl-5,6,7,12-tetrahydrodibenz[b,g]azocine-3,9-diyl) PSiO). These polymers have new heterocyclic unit. Not only UV and Cyclic voltammetry (CV) measurements but also X-ray crystallography of the related dibromide suggested that the structure of the bridging unit affected pi-conjugation through the N atom. The highest conductivities of electrochemically doped PDSiAzep and PSiO were 2.0 x 10(-4) and 1.3 x 10(-2), respectively. Turn-on bias voltage of a double layer electroluminescent device comprising PDSiAzep was higher than that of PSiO. These electrical properties were depended on effective a-conjugation through the N atom.
